About
Mundo-LLN is a flagship sustainable construction project in Wallonia, developed by Mundo-Lab. Located in Louvain-la-Neuve, it combines the renovation of a former farm with the construction of a 2,300 m² modular building designed to host NGOs, non-profits, and social enterprises. Designed by A2M architects, the project embraces circular economy and eco-design principles: a 100% reused steel frame, bio-based materials, and recovered furniture and equipment. The underground parking was conceived to be convertible into office space, enhancing modularity and adaptability. Mundo-LLN aims to reduce carbon footprint, promote reuse, and create a collaborative work environment. It is part of the Circular Wallonia strategy and stands as an innovative model for low-impact buildings.
